NEAR Protocol is a decentralized blockchain platform that aims to provide a fast, scalable, and user-friendly platform for developing and deploying applications. It was founded in 2017 by a team of experienced engineers and entrepreneurs, including Illia Polosukhin and Erik Trautman. NEAR Protocol is headquartered in San Francisco, California, United States.
NEAR Protocol has been the subject of some speculation regarding its national origin, with some suggesting that it is a Chinese national public blockchain. However, this is not the case. NEAR Protocol is a global, open-source project that is not affiliated with any particular country or government. The NEAR Protocol team is composed of individuals from all over the world, and the project is supported by a diverse group of investors and partners.
NEAR Protocol's technology is based on a number of innovative concepts, including sharding, proof-of-stake, and the NEAR Virtual Machine (NVM). Sharding is a technique that divides the blockchain into smaller, more manageable pieces, which can be processed in parallel. This allows NEAR Protocol to achieve high levels of scalability and performance. Proof-of-stake is a consensus mechanism that allows users to validate transactions and earn rewards based on the amount of NEAR tokens they hold. This makes NEAR Protocol more energy-efficient than traditional proof-of-work blockchains.
The NEAR Virtual Machine (NVM) is a runtime environment that allows developers to write and deploy smart contracts in a variety of programming languages. This makes NEAR Protocol more accessible to developers and makes it easier to build and deploy complex applications. NEAR Protocol also has a number of features that make it user-friendly, including a built-in wallet and a simple-to-use interface.
